THE COUNCIL comprises representatives of the fire service, industry and the public, all of whom have a profound concern about fire safety. Working on an entirely voluntary basis, the members pool their collective knowledge, expertise and resources to help shape the direction of fire safety strategies in Ontario. Members represent a wide variety of associations, organizations, groups and individuals in fire safety, including the fire service, insurance, government (provincial and municipal), health and safety, First Nations, older adults, media and private citizens. With the introduction of the Fire Protection and Prevention Act, 1997 (FPPA), the Council was established as a non-profit corporation without share capital, under the law (Part XI, Section 60). This required the Council to put into place an organizational structure that would serve its members and meet the responsibilities of its new official status. The Council now operates under a structure that includes a Chair, two Vice-Chairs, an Executive Committee, a Board of Directors and five Standing Committees.

The Chair initially appoints members for a period of three years, with the option of renewal. The Council structure includes a Chair, two Vice-Chairs and a Secretary-Treasurer. The Fire Marshal of Ontario chairs the Council, and in his absence, the Deputy Fire Marshal. An Executive Committee and Board of Directors manage the affairs of the Council. The Council holds biannual General meetings, quarterly Executive Committee meetings and Standing Committee meetings as required. The public, media, industry and special interest groups are invited to attend the biannual meetings.
